WHAT YOU NEED:
HOW TO MAKE:
Trace snowflakes onto your watercolour paper. You can trace with a pencil first, then go over with watercolour markers OR go directly to watercolour markers!
Use water and a paintbrush to turn your marker ink into "paint". Brush the colour away from the snowflake's interior to add colour to the space between the snowflakes. The snowflake interiors will remain white :)
Allow art to dry!
